Common issues and what they traditionally mean
The same symptom can mean various things based on age and heritage. I’ll record everyday signs and symptoms and the most seemingly prognosis, then what that implies approximately restore versus substitute.
A noisy door: If the door appears like a freight practice both going up or down, you’re almost always shopping at worn rollers, dry or failing bearings, unfastened hardware, or a failing opener. Older doors with metallic rollers and sealed bearings are noisier than nylon rollers, and exchanging rollers and lubricating hardware most likely fixes matters for in your price range, quick-time period results. If noise is paired with wobble and the door is extra than 15 years historical, the tracks, hinges, and panels is likely to be out of alignment or warped, and a substitute probably a greater lengthy-term funding.
Slow or asymmetric move: Motor complications, bent tracks, damaged springs, or a door it is long past out of steadiness can rationale sluggish or jerky action. Broken torsion springs are in style and unsafe to deal with alone. Spring substitute is a common repair with notably low check, but if springs fail many times resulting from a sagging observe or rusted cable drums, dissimilar repairs are a red flag that the door constitution is failing.
Door won’t close or opens a bit of then reverses: Safety sensors might possibly be misaligned, wiring is likely to be damaged, or the opener’s power settings could possibly be off. This is primarily an opener repair. However, if the door has warped backside seals or rotten sections that go back and forth sensors intermittently, substitute of these sections or the complete door will be valuable.
Dents, rust, and ruined panels: A few small dents or surface rust spots is additionally repaired, however fashionable rust throughout the door or many damaged panels signifies the door is near the give up of its purposeful lifestyles. Replacing several panels is one could, yet matching paint and profiles is more and more not easy as styles alternate. If the door is unique to a homestead that’s two decades or older, alternative is most often the purifier solution.

Cost considerations, with realistic numbers
Repair prices vary with part and hard work. I’ll deliver ranges you will count on in Colorado Springs, but your local contractor’s quote is the remaining observe.
- Spring replacement: almost always between $150 and $300 in line with spring based on fashion and labor. Torsion springs value extra than extension springs. Opener restoration or substitute: minor upkeep and reprogramming should be $seventy five to $a hundred and fifty. A new opener setting up levels from $300 to $900 based on horsepower and shrewd options. Roller and hinge replacements: changing rollers could be $one hundred to $250 for constituents and labor; hinges are continuously reasonable constituents but labor provides up if many need changing. Panel replacement: a unmarried panel replacement runs $150 to $400, depending on material and end. Matching older doors would possibly push the settlement up. Full door substitute: a new mid-range insulated metal door established will most likely fall between $900 and $2,000. High-give up doors in wood or carriage-residence vogue can run $2,500 to $6,000 or more.
These numbers are approximate. Warranties replace the calculus. A new door with a 10-year warranty on springs and hardware can provide peace of thoughts that repetitive maintenance do no longer.

Case one: the 1998 metallic door with a new opener. A home-owner referred to as on account that the opener turned into failing. I replaced the opener for $600 and tuned the door, yet two years later the springs broke. At that factor the door had wide rust and warped panels. A moment fix may have price very nearly 1/2 the charge of replacing the total door. We opted for replacement with an insulated steel door for about $1,six hundred. The lesson: changing the opener acquired convenience, but the door's age meant greater disorders had been coming.
Case two: the condominium estate with a noisy door. A landlord complained about noise and tenant complaints. I replaced rollers with nylon rollers, tightened hardware, and lubricated moving portions for $180. The door turned into 10 years historic, in perfect structure in a different way, and the landlord saved cost. A complete alternative would no longer have been payment efficient.
Case three: the dented carriage-taste panels. A delivery driving force hit the door and bent 3 panels. Matching panels for that sort had been not produced. The house owner were planning a remodel and made a decision to replace the finished door with a modern equivalent that stored the minimize allure, for a web fee change small enough given the redesign price range. Matching components availability topics greater than other people are expecting.
Energy and insulation: while it can pay to replace
If your storage houses a workshop or is connected to conditioned house, insulation issues. A non-insulated steel door generally has an R-fee round R-zero.five to R-3 depending on thickness and development. Modern insulated doors ordinarily achieve R-6 to R-12. That doesn’t mean you’ll save heaps each winter, however the brought insulation reduces warm switch, lowers the burden on a pressured-air unit in an attached space, and continues pipes from freezing in borderline eventualities. If you've a dwelling area above the garage, insulation and air sealing most likely justify substitute, on the grounds that retrofitting an historic door infrequently achieves the identical performance.
Safety and liability: why possible’t defer detailed repairs
Broken torsion springs and frayed cables are risky. Springs retailer vigor and might lead to excessive harm after they fail. If a spring breaks, don’t attempt to near or open the door, and do not test a DIY restore except you are educated and fitted. Similarly, if sensors are defective and the door reverses unpredictably, that may be an immediate danger for children and pets. These are maintenance to prioritize without reference to whether or not you update the door later.
When to improve elements as opposed to the door
Sometimes the opener is the weak hyperlink. Replacing a loud or underpowered opener can repair quiet operation and upload convenience capabilities like battery backup or telephone integration. If the door itself is structurally sound, a new opener will be the such a lot charge-effectual improve. Consider horsepower ratings: a unmarried-door insulated panel would desire 1/2 horsepower, even as greater and heavier doors basically function more effective with three/4 horsepower or superior. If you add a heavier insulated door, plan to improve the opener thus.

Timing and preventive care that extend life
A little protection is going a protracted method. Clean tracks, do away with grit, lubricate rollers and hinges with a silicone-centered or white lithium grease as advised, and inspect the balance once a year. A door that is out of steadiness will increase wear on springs and the opener. Replace weatherstripping while it tears. Tighten loose bolts. Have springs inspected yearly by using a authentic. Preventive work delays replacements and keeps restoration expenses cut back.
When you opt for alternative, make design choices that matter
Material offerings affect upkeep, toughness, and charge. Steel is such a lot commonplace and can provide low maintenance with long life if accomplished appropriately. Insulated metal panel doorways provide really good price. Aluminum seems to be innovative and resists rust but dents greater comfortably. Wood offers traditional magnificence however calls for periodic refinishing, and fluctuating humidity in Colorado can lead to warping if not well-developed. Consider glass panels should you want normal pale, however account for privacy and capability warmness advantage. Hardware styles and colors, window styles, and insulation degree switch equally objective and cut back enchantment, so pick what matches your place and budget.
